Square Enix has revealed that it will launch a major video game between April 2019 and March 2020, although there's no clue yet as to what it might be. I'd probably not bet in favour of Final Fantasy VII Remake, though.

The news comes during the publisher's latest financial results, where it also revealed that Shadow of the Tomb Raider shipped 4.12 million copies for the quarter September – December 2019.

Just Cause 4 was also released during this period, and the company is hoping to give sales a shot in the arm via updates and 'other initiatives.'

Square Enix is looking to reduce the time between announcing a game and its release, too, which is probably a wise choice considering Final Fantasy VII Remake was unveiled nearly four years ago and we still don't have a date.

There's also the Avengers project that's still knocking around, although it's been a while since we heard about that, too.
